Validators work (RIPD-703):
This replaces the experimental validators module with foundational code to implement a new system for tracking validators, validations and the UNL. The code is turned off by default, in BeastConfig.h * Remove obsolete public Manager interfaces * Remove obsolete database methods * Remove obsolete ChosenList concept * Remove obsolete code * Add missing includes * Tidy up STValidation.h * Move factory function to Validators::make_Manager * Add Connection object for tracking STValidations
